Public Member Functions | Private Attributes | Friends
BFL::BFL::Probability Class Reference

Class representing a probability (a double between 0 and 1) More...

#include <mixtureParticleFilter.h>

List of all members.

Public Member Functions

double getValue () const
double getValue () const
double getValue () const
double getValue () const
 operator double ()
 operator double ()
 operator double ()
 operator double ()
Probability operator* (Probability p)
Probability operator* (Probability p)
Probability operator* (Probability p)
Probability operator* (Probability p)
Probability operator/ (Probability p)
Probability operator/ (Probability p)
Probability operator/ (Probability p)
Probability operator/ (Probability p)
 Probability ()
 Probability ()
 Probability ()
 Probability ()
 Probability (double p)
 Probability (double p)
 Probability (double p)
 Probability (double p)
virtual ~Probability ()
virtual ~Probability ()
virtual ~Probability ()
virtual ~Probability ()

Private Attributes

double _prob

Friends

ostream & operator<< (ostream &stream, Probability &prob)
ostream & operator<< (ostream &stream, Probability &prob)
ostream & operator<< (ostream &stream, Probability &prob)
ostream & operator<< (ostream &stream, Probability &prob)
istream & operator>> (istream &stream, Probability &prob)
istream & operator>> (istream &stream, Probability &prob)
istream & operator>> (istream &stream, Probability &prob)
istream & operator>> (istream &stream, Probability &prob)

Detailed Description

Class representing a probability (a double between 0 and 1)

Definition at line 40 of file mixtureParticleFilter.h.


Constructor & Destructor Documentation

Definition at line 43 of file mixtureParticleFilter.h.

BFL::BFL::Probability::Probability ( double  p) [inline]

Definition at line 44 of file mixtureParticleFilter.h.

virtual BFL::BFL::Probability::~Probability ( ) [inline, virtual]

Definition at line 52 of file mixtureParticleFilter.h.

Definition at line 43 of file mixtureParticleFilter.h.

BFL::BFL::Probability::Probability ( double  p) [inline]

Definition at line 44 of file mixtureParticleFilter.h.

virtual BFL::BFL::Probability::~Probability ( ) [inline, virtual]

Definition at line 52 of file mixtureParticleFilter.h.

Definition at line 43 of file particlefilter.h.

BFL::BFL::Probability::Probability ( double  p) [inline]

Definition at line 44 of file particlefilter.h.

virtual BFL::BFL::Probability::~Probability ( ) [inline, virtual]

Definition at line 52 of file particlefilter.h.

Definition at line 43 of file particlesmoother.h.

BFL::BFL::Probability::Probability ( double  p) [inline]

Definition at line 44 of file particlesmoother.h.

virtual BFL::BFL::Probability::~Probability ( ) [inline, virtual]

Definition at line 52 of file particlesmoother.h.


Member Function Documentation

double BFL::BFL::Probability::getValue ( ) const [inline]

Definition at line 72 of file mixtureParticleFilter.h.

double BFL::BFL::Probability::getValue ( ) const [inline]

Definition at line 72 of file mixtureParticleFilter.h.

double BFL::BFL::Probability::getValue ( ) const [inline]

Definition at line 72 of file particlefilter.h.

double BFL::BFL::Probability::getValue ( ) const [inline]

Definition at line 72 of file particlesmoother.h.

BFL::BFL::Probability::operator double ( ) [inline]

Definition at line 74 of file mixtureParticleFilter.h.

BFL::BFL::Probability::operator double ( ) [inline]

Definition at line 74 of file particlefilter.h.

BFL::BFL::Probability::operator double ( ) [inline]

Definition at line 74 of file mixtureParticleFilter.h.

BFL::BFL::Probability::operator double ( ) [inline]

Definition at line 74 of file particlesmoother.h.

Probability BFL::BFL::Probability::operator* ( Probability  p) [inline]

Definition at line 75 of file mixtureParticleFilter.h.

Probability BFL::BFL::Probability::operator* ( Probability  p) [inline]

Definition at line 75 of file particlesmoother.h.

Probability BFL::BFL::Probability::operator* ( Probability  p) [inline]

Definition at line 75 of file particlefilter.h.

Probability BFL::BFL::Probability::operator* ( Probability  p) [inline]

Definition at line 75 of file mixtureParticleFilter.h.

Probability BFL::BFL::Probability::operator/ ( Probability  p) [inline]

Definition at line 77 of file mixtureParticleFilter.h.

Probability BFL::BFL::Probability::operator/ ( Probability  p) [inline]

Definition at line 77 of file particlesmoother.h.

Probability BFL::BFL::Probability::operator/ ( Probability  p) [inline]

Definition at line 77 of file particlefilter.h.

Probability BFL::BFL::Probability::operator/ ( Probability  p) [inline]

Definition at line 77 of file mixtureParticleFilter.h.


Friends And Related Function Documentation

ostream& operator<< ( ostream &  stream,
Probability prob 
) [friend]
ostream& operator<< ( ostream &  stream,
Probability prob 
) [friend]
ostream& operator<< ( ostream &  stream,
Probability prob 
) [friend]
ostream& operator<< ( ostream &  stream,
Probability prob 
) [friend]
istream& operator>> ( istream &  stream,
Probability prob 
) [friend]
istream& operator>> ( istream &  stream,
Probability prob 
) [friend]
istream& operator>> ( istream &  stream,
Probability prob 
) [friend]
istream& operator>> ( istream &  stream,
Probability prob 
) [friend]

Member Data Documentation

double BFL::BFL::Probability::_prob [private]

Definition at line 78 of file mixtureParticleFilter.h.


The documentation for this class was generated from the following file:


bfl
Author(s): Klaas Gadeyne, Wim Meeussen, Tinne Delaet and many others. See web page for a full contributor list. ROS package maintained by Wim Meeussen.
autogenerated on Thu Feb 11 2016 22:31:59